About St George's School

St George's School is a secondary school in Harpenden, Hertfordshire, classified by the DfE as an academy converter with a Christian religious character. Around 1,362 pupils aged 11 to 18 attend the school. In the most recent GCSE results, pupils achieved an average Attainment 8 score of 63.7, well above the national average of 46. That is down 0.5 points in its Attainment 8 score on the previous year. On our composite score, which combines the DfE attainment measures above, this places it among the top 6% of secondary schools in England.

77% of pupils achieved a grade 5 or above in both English and maths, well above the national average of about 45%. 90% achieved a standard pass (grade 4+) in English and maths. Its intake is relatively advantaged, with around 5% of pupils eligible for free school meals in the last six years versus about 24% nationally. St George's School does not currently have a recent graded Ofsted judgement on record (often the case for newer or recently converted schools), so it is worth asking when its next inspection is expected.
